Every morning i feed the birds a little snack of suet and watch them while drinking my morning coffee.
I have a magpie called marcus who sometimes taps on the window and wakes me up if i sleep in too late.

Yesterday, i was mobbed by starlings. They are a noisy, gregarious bunch and they have fledglings with them as well at the moment so it's extra loud. I love watching their chaos.

After they cleaned out the feeder, i noticed something in there....it was a perfect, tiny little flower bud. Likely accidentally dropped from someones beak when they landed, but i am goimg to let myself believe it was an intentional gift.

Canada geese. Birds of the weekend.

We live along the Stour estuary and in spring and autumn we get huge flocks honking in their v formations over our home. I wild swim in the estuary and when i went in yesterday the first of the goslings have been born. I was super cautious as Canada geese are fiercely protective of their nesting sites and young. I didn't outstay my welcome, and i didnt take my eyes off the male (who was watching me the whole time) hopefully we can respectfully co-exist over the coming weeks until the babies are bigger and the parents become less territorial.
I couldn't get a photo of the babies as i didn't want to get too close πŸͺΏπŸŒŠ
